I appeared for an interview in Aug 2016.

Interview Preparation Tips

Round: Test
Experience: This includes logical thinking and grammar in the first 2 sections. Technical questions were based on the branch like core mechanical or electrical.
Tips: Should be fast and fundamentals must be strong
Duration: 1 hour 30 minutes

Round: Group Discussion
Experience: They gave us sometime and a sheet of paper to prepare ourselves in their presence. Then they asked us to start discussing.
Tips: Confidence and communication skills must be strong. It doesn't mean speaking fluently, but one should be clear maintaining eye contact. Also, should pay attention to everyone else, in other words one should listen and speak viz.

Round: Technical Interview
Experience: This happened based on the resume. Questions regarding Projects and internship were asked. Mostly fundamental.
Tips: Know everything that you mention in your resume. Be strong in fundamentals and be confident.
